  • Clean and replace your air filter. Taking this simple duty seriously can prevent a lot of problems with your AC. Your air filter is designed to prevent the buildup of dust and other debris on your fan blades, motors, coils, and other parts of the system, so as to maintain system performance and efficiency. However, when it becomes clogged or excessively dirty, the air filter can actually be counter-productive and cause your system to work harder; it may even cause your evaporator coils to freeze.
  • Make room. Make sure the area surrounding your AC is adequately ventilated so that air can pass freely throughout the various components. It also ensures that heat can adequately dissipate into the air outside, which is essential to the refrigerant cycle.
